WASHINGTON — (AP) — Mexican authorities recently extradited Néstor Isidro Pérez Salas, also known as “El Nini,” a prominent assassin for the notorious Sinaloa drug cartel, to the United States. The Justice Department announced on Saturday that Pérez Salas will face charges related to drug trafficking, possession of firearms, and witness retaliation.

Pérez Salas is a key figure in a group responsible for providing security to the sons of the incarcerated drug lord Joaquín “El Chapo” Guzmán. This group, commonly referred to as the “little Chapos” or “Chapitos,” has been identified as a major exporter of the lethal synthetic opioid fentanyl to the U.S., contributing to approximately 70,000 overdose deaths annually in the country.

U.S. Attorney General Merrick Garland stated, “We allege El Nini was one of the Sinaloa Cartel’s lead sicarios, or assassins, and was responsible for the murder, torture, and kidnapping of rivals and witnesses who threatened the cartel’s criminal drug trafficking enterprise.”

The U.S. Drug Enforcement Administration had previously offered a $3 million reward for the capture of Pérez Salas, who was apprehended at a fortified property in Culiacan, the capital of Sinaloa state, in November last year. President Joe Biden expressed gratitude to Mexican President Andrés Manuel López Obrador for facilitating Pérez Salas’s extradition.

President Biden affirmed the commitment of both governments to combat the fentanyl and synthetic drug crisis, which has claimed numerous lives in the U.S. and worldwide. He emphasised the joint efforts to bring criminals and organisations involved in producing, smuggling, and selling these deadly substances to justice.

Nicknamed “Nini,” Pérez Salas is known for his involvement in brutal acts of violence. Former DEA official Mike Vigil described him as “a complete psychopath.” Pérez Salas led a security team called the Ninis, notorious for their extreme tactics and military-style training.

According to court documents, Pérez Salas and his associates engaged in heinous acts, including the torture of a Mexican federal agent in 2017. The Ninis were involved in capturing rivals and taking them to Chapitos-owned ranches for execution, with some victims allegedly fed to tigers kept by the Chapitos.
